Most Popular Veterinary Medicine Schools in the Southwest Region

4 Ranked Colleges
489 Veterinary Medicine Graduations

Veterinary Medicine is offered at a wide range of schools. To top this list, a school graduates more veterinary medicine students than other colleges offering the major.

To build this ranking, College Factual compared yearly graduations across the 4 schools in the Southwest Region offering veterinary medicine.

The colleges and universities below are the most popular for veterinary medicine majors in the Southwest Region, ranked by the number of degrees they award each year.

1

The most popular school in the country for veterinary medicine students is Texas A And M University College Station. Texas A And M University College Station is a public school located in the city of College Station. This school awarded about 152 veterinary medicine degrees in the most recent year. 2

Midwestern University Glendale is one of the most popular veterinary medicine schools, landing the #2 spot this year. Midwestern University Glendale is a private not-for-profit school located in the suburb of Glendale. During the most recent year for which we have data, roughly 126 students earned a degree in veterinary medicine from this school. 3

A rank of #3 makes University Of Arizona one of the most popular schools for veterinary medicine. Set in the city of Tucson, University Of Arizona is a public institution. 4

Oklahoma State University Main Campus ranks #4 for veterinary medicine by yearly graduations. Oklahoma State University Main Campus is a public school located in the town of Stillwater.
